This minor cliff lies between Penberth and Porthguarnon.

Approach notes

Take the coast path eastwards from Penberth until you can see St. Loy and the top of Porthguarnon East. Just before the path turns slightly left, there is a rocky section. Descend via a faint path through the blackthorn over a short rock step. Turn right and fight through the undergrowth and over a gap to where the rock gets steeper; a perched boulder over on the left signals the cliff top. Now trend rightwards, aiming for a triangular-shaped boulder, from which a short scramble leads down a steep vegetated slope.
